# Scientific Objective
# --------------------
#
# The TC-RMW tool regrids tropical cyclone model data onto a moving range-azimuth grid centered on points along the storm track. This capability replicates the NOAA Hurricane Research Division DIA-Post module.

# METplus Components
# ------------------
#
# This use case utilizes the METplus TCRMW wrapper to search for
# the desired ADECK file and forecast files that are correspond to the track.
# It generates a command to run the MET tool TC-RMW if all required files are found.

# METplus Workflow
# ----------------
#
# **Beginning time (INIT_BEG):** 2014101312
#
# **End time (INIT_END):** 2014101312
#
# **Increment between beginning and end times (INIT_INCREMENT):** 6H
#
# **Sequence of forecast leads to process (LEAD_SEQ):** begin_end_incr(0, 24, 6)
#
# TCRMW is the only tool called in this example. It processes the following
# run times:
#
# | **Init:** 2014-10-13 12Z
# | **Forecast lead:** 0, 6, 12, 18, and 24 hour
